Nathan Palmer, WR, (5-11, 192) — Palmer ran the 40-yard dash in 4.34 seconds with the wind at his back, and clocked in at 4.43 seconds running into it. He registered a 37-inch vertical, 10-foot-5 broad jump, a 4.25-second short shuttle and a 6.92-second three-cone. He has 33-inch-long arms and did 13 strength lifts. He had an excellent, drop-free workout.

I think you picked some good players, but I'd be disappointed if we did not get more front 7, specifically defensive end help than that. Our defensive line has been more ignored in the draft than nearly any unit around the league. I can't think of very many 3-4 teams that I would not trade defensive ends. I'm alot happier kicking the can down the road at safety than not addressing our defensive ends. By any measure you are much more likely to get lucky on a 3rd 4th or 5th round safety than finding a defensive end.
